Output e5fcf504050422903f1d11e64e6ac29556cc4e84ad3e05b0892c2d1b0760d3a1:10

value
87416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f17a4aab4b272b93fe7fb7df192a5452cc43ef OP_EQUAL
address
3HYk6tsz3bMwysS5tS9YX2wE9EQnYNLEhQ
transaction
e5fcf504050422903f1d11e64e6ac29556cc4e84ad3e05b0892c2d1b0760d3a1
confirmations
204906
spent
true